How to connect: Vega Chargers

Connect your Vega ALOHA Lander charger to Plugchoice through its embedded web server.

Requirements

  • A laptop with an Ethernet port and an Ethernet cable

  • The ALOHA Lander installation manual

  • The charger's serial number (on the System information page)

Good to know: the Vega ALOHA Lander is configured through the embedded web server (EWS). No vehicles may be charging during configuration.


Connect your charger

  1. Open the frontal door of the charger.

  2. Plug the Ethernet cable into your laptop and the port on the A7 PCB, behind the HMI screen, next to the USB port.

  3. Set your laptop's Ethernet adapter to IP 192.168.1.50, subnet 255.255.255.0.

  4. On the authentication page, turn user authentication on and select OCPP-RFID.

  5. On the connectivity page, choose Ethernet or Cellular.

  6. On the OCPP Settings page, set the central system endpoint to ws://proxy.plugchoice.com/v1.

  7. Set Charge box ID to the charger's serial number.

  8. Press apply and reboot (top right).


Registering your charger in Plugchoice

  1. Add the charger using the chargepoint ID. For Vega Chargers, this is the Charge box ID, usually the serial number (case sensitive).

Done! The charger should come online.


Troubleshooting

Did you set everything up correctly, but the charger still remains "Pre-registered"?

  • The chargepoint ID in Plugchoice must exactly match the Charge box ID.

  • EWS unreachable? Check the fixed IP on your laptop (192.168.1.50).

  • Using cellular? Check the SIM is inserted correctly in the modem (A5 PCB).

  • Reboot the charger after changing the settings.
